If you just wanted to play a round of Elden Ring and encountered connection problems with the servers, then there is a reason: like developer FromSoftware a few minutes ago has announced maintenance work is currently in progress Patch 1.04 for the action role-playing game.

How long are the servers offline?

  • Start of maintenance work: 10 O `clock
  • End of maintenance work: around 11 a.m

According to the developer, all platforms are affected. During this time, you will not be able to play on PlayStation consoles (PS4/PS5), Xbox consoles (One/Series), or on PC.

Prepare for patch 1.04

Of course, there is a good reason why the servers are offline. Patch 1.04 should be available for download around 11 a.m. German time. We will inform you of the changes promptly in this article.

What has changed with Patch 1.03? Recently there was a small hotfix that screwed up the balancing of the game. More precisely, it was about attacks by Boss Radahn, who now deals more damage. Before that, patch 1.03 fixed some NPC quests that couldn’t be completed before. A new supporting character was also added with a vessel child.
